Output 3ec728ab5973e5ef3c6da2e0c1884579f1da6681ae454d5baf12d7919d1df0a7:1

value
2082526
script pubkey
OP_0 OP_PUSHBYTES_20 c531b5aa82b74961c2db97a205f12a32acc07b5f
address
ltc1qc5cmt25zkaykrskmj73qtuf2x2kvq76lmwvy9e
transaction
3ec728ab5973e5ef3c6da2e0c1884579f1da6681ae454d5baf12d7919d1df0a7
spent
true